![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Фрилансер
Пользователь
Регистрация: 12.01.2007
Сообщений: 15
|
![]()
Подскажите, пожалуйста, кто чем богат:
Почему следующий код не печатает на матричном принтере, а только на струйном и лазерном: with Printer do begin BeginDoc; Canvas.TextRect(Rect(200,200,PageWi dth-200,PageHeight-200), 200, 200, Memo1.Lines.Text); EndDoc; end; И как мне заставить работать на меня матричного динозавра? Последний раз редактировалось Dimon; 11.07.2008 в 09:29. |
![]() |
![]() |
![]() |
#2 |
Участник клуба
Регистрация: 12.10.2007
Сообщений: 1,204
|
![]()
Почему не печатает, затрудняюсь. М.б. что-то с драйверами. Или принтер настолько старый, что не поддерживает графического режима. Хотя, по-моему, таких не было.
А заставить печатать в текстовом режиме можно просто выводом в файл: Код:
Можно предварительно проверить работоспособность этого варианта командой с консоли - отправить на печать маленький файл: copy c:\boot.ini prn |
![]() |
![]() |
![]() |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Печать | <<>>KaRaPuz<<>> | Общие вопросы Delphi | 3 | 31.05.2008 20:59 |
Печать из OLE | Experementator | Общие вопросы Delphi | 1 | 25.04.2008 20:25 |
отмена печати на принтере в Delphi | Юliana | Общие вопросы Delphi | 2 | 29.01.2008 19:51 |
Печать | lacost | Общие вопросы C/C++ | 2 | 09.12.2007 22:55 |
количество распечатанных файлов на принтере | ZhekON | Общие вопросы Delphi | 4 | 31.08.2007 21:16 |